Job Purpose:
The Associate General Counsel will support the office of the General Counsel and be a key member of the Legal Department, providing legal advice and consultation on a variety of issues mainly relating to the business activities of the Company's treasury and securitization functions.

Essential Job Functions (Duties/Responsibilities)
  • The Associate General Counsel will have the following duties and responsibilities, including but not limited to:
  • Provide legal support for the Company's mortgage warehouse and repurchase facilities and its secured and unsecured credit facilities, and the Company's treasury function generally;
  • Work on CRE commercial loan obligation securitizations (and similar vehicles);
  • Provide legal advice and consultation to the treasury and securitization functions in connection with daily operational matters, such as loan transfer and compliance issues;
  • Provide guidance and advice to various business units within the Company;
  • Manage internal business relationships; and
  • General corporate compliance and legal assistance, including but not limited to drafting and review of contracts, including those related to the Company's joint ventures

Qualifications:
Education: A Bachelor's degree and J.D. are required with strong academic credentials from an accredited law school.

Experience: Minimum of 7 years-experience with commercial finance transactions and mortgage warehouse facilities. Commercial loan securitization and CMBS experience a plus.
